Vitamins

Biology; Cell biology

A diverse group of organic molecules that are required for metabolic reactions and generally cannot be synthesised in the body.

White blood cell

Biology; Cell biology

Component of the blood that functions in the immune system. Also known as a leukocyte.

Wood

Biology; Cell biology

The inner layer of the stems of woody plants; composed of xylem.

Viroids

Biology; Cell biology

Infective forms of nucleic acid without a protective coat of protein; unencapsulated single-stranded RNA molecules. Naked RNA, possibly of degenerated virus, that infects plants.

Virus

Biology; Cell biology

Infectious chemical agent composed of a nucleic acid (DNA or RNA) inside a protein coat.

Vestigial structures

Biology; Cell biology

Nonfunctional remains of organs that were functional in ancestral species and may still be functional in related species; e.g., the dewclaws of dogs.

Villi

Biology; Cell biology
